Today’ s lecture we’ll centre on the people who lived five thousand years ago in the Sahara Desert. Now most of these desert people moved across the countryside throughout the year. You might think that they’re wandering aimlessly. Far from it, they actually followed the series of carefully planned moves.
Where they moved depended on where food was available, places where plants were ripening or with lots offish. Now often when these people moved, they carried all their possessions on their backs. But if the journey was long, extra food and tools were sometimes stored in caves.
One of these caves is now an exciting historic site. Even though the cave is very large, it was certainly too dark and dusty for people to live in, but it was a great place to hide things. And huge amounts of food supplies and daily tools have been found there.
The food includes dried fish and nuts. The tools include stone spear points and knives. The spear points are actually rather small. Here is a picture of some that were found. You can see their size in relation to the hands holding them.
There are also some decorations found in the caves. There are necklaces, ear rings, etc. Most of them were made of bones, instead of some rare metals like what those are today. We may not like the idea of it. But it was very popular at that time. From the above talk, we can see there ’re really great differences from our lives today.
